Fine printing from the respected Tokyo publisher Oedo Mokuhansha - These classic designs were produced by the well known Tokyo publisher Oedo Mokuhansha amidst a resurgence of interest in ukiyo-e. Like many of these traditional businesses, the woodblock print craft was passed down through generations, and the Oedo Mokuhansha company was formed by descendents of an Edo era publisher. These are nice prints of the highest quality standards and an excellent choice if you are looking for fine old woodblock reprints.

Comments - Lovely design of two white herons wading in a pond bordered with purple irises and tall grasses waving gracefully in the breeze. A beautiful color palette with the water and sky softly shaded in rich tones of blue and aqua. A very handsome kacho-e (birds and flowers print) subject that would make a fantastic display. Printed on a tan paper to simulate an aged appearance.
